Cal Beaufontaine, son of a Creole restaurateur and a recent graduate from culinary school, is starting his career as an apprentice chef in Modesto, California. His newly renovated apartment borders a derelict peach farm, Sullivan's Yard, and the lingering scent of peaches inspires dreams of making love to a sexy but faceless man in his backyard beneath a peach tree in full bloom. On his first day at the Alhambra, a top restaurant in the city, Cal encopnters Luis, the owner's nephew and one-night stand expert. Luis begins a determined seduction campaign, but while Cal is immediately attracted he has no intention of becoming a notch on Luis's bedpost. Yet his driving ambition to learn all he can and run his own restaurant could be knocked off-track by his growing desire for the Spaniard.
